    Congratulations, your plugin is very useful.
    But contrary to what you describe in the features, the plugin does not work with conditional logic.
    I tested with a dropdown whose name is “function” and implemented conditional logic so that if certain option was selected then another field is visible.
    If the dropdown “Function” is within the repeater, conditional logic does not work. If the dropdown is out then everything works beautifully.
